Bill Text: OR HJM14 | 2013 | Regular Session | Enrolled
Bill Title: Urging Congress to enact legislation permitting negotiation of drug prices and rebates on behalf of Medicare recipients.

77th OREGON LEGISLATIVE ASSEMBLY--2013 Regular Session Enrolled House Joint Memorial 14 Sponsored by Representative BUCKLEY To the President of the United States and the Senate and the House of Representatives of the United States of America, in Congress assembled: We, your memorialists, the Seventy-seventh Legislative Assembly of the State of Oregon, in legislative session assembled, respectfully represent as follows: Whereas the rising cost of health care in the United States is a major driver for budgets at the national, state and household levels; and Whereas the cost of prescription medications is a major contributor to health care cost increases; and Whereas prescription drug companies in the United States receive the benefit of special patent protections and prohibitions against the reimportation of less expensive prescriptions available in other countries, including Canada; and Whereas in the United States, unlike in many other countries in the world, prescription drug companies are permitted to engage in extensive direct-to-consumer marketing; and Whereas private consumers and publicly funded health care programs in the United States pay more for prescription medications than those in any other country in the world; and Whereas although federal agencies such as the United States Department of Veterans Affairs and the Indian Health Service are permitted to negotiate with prescription drug companies for drug rebates, such negotiation on behalf of Medicare recipients is prohibited; now, therefore, Be It Resolved by the Legislative Assembly of the State of Oregon: (1) The Congress of the United States of America is respectfully urged to enact legislation permitting the United States Secretary of Health and Human Services to negotiate drug prices and rebates for Medicare recipients. (2) A copy of this memorial shall be sent to the President of the United States, to the Senate Majority Leader, to the Speaker of the House of Representatives and to each member of the Oregon Congressional Delegation. ---------- Enrolled House Joint Memorial 14 (HJM 14-INTRO) Page 1 Adopted by House May 2, 2013 ---------------------------------- Ramona J.
